Black Myth: Wukong is filled with countless challenges. However, you can find some breathing room in certain locations, ones that offer peace and tranquility in a journey that's fraught with peril.

Here's our guide to help you find all Meditation Spots in Black Myth: Wukong. Where to find all Meditation Spots in Black Myth: Wukong There are a total of 24 Meditation Spots in Black Myth: Wukong. These are spread all over five of the game's main regions.



Once you see this point-of-interest, which looks like an object with a golden glow, interact with it to trigger a cutscene. The cutscene shows your immediate surroundings. Moreover, you instantly gain one Spark, a skill point that can be allocated to unlock new talents and perks.

Note that you can open the menu and go to the Journal page. This shows all Meditation Spots that you've unlocked in your playthrough. Forest of Wolves: Front Hills/Outside the Forest - Go up the sloping path after Bullguard battle but before the next shrine (Outside the Forest).

This will likely be the first Black Myth: Wukong Meditation Spot that you'll stumble upon in your playthrough. Bamboo Grove: Back Hills - Head down the sloping path past Guanyin Temple and look to your left to see a small cave opening. The horse NPC can be found inside this cave as well.

Bamboo Grove: Marsh of White Mist - Go past the small cave after beating the Whiteclad Noble and check the vista to your left. Note that there's a Celestial Taiyi Pill upgrade next to this point-of-interest. Sandgate Village: Village Entrance - This is at the top of a rocky area overlooking the Lang-Li-Guhh-Baw frog boss.

Fright Cliff: Rockcrest Flat - To find this Meditation Spot in Black Myth: Wukong, keep going straight past the Rockcrest Flat shrine. In the next open area, you’ll see the Drunk Boar NPC. Just beyond this fella a Meditation Spot next to a gnarled tree.

Note: The Drunk Boar NPC is actually part of the Chapter 2 secret area side quest . Fright Cliff: Rock Crash Platform - Go down the steps after beating the Stone Vanguard boss. You should see this point-of-interest at the edge of a cliff.

Crouching Tiger Temple: Temple Entrance - To your left just before the Tiger Vanguard boss fight. Crouching Tiger Temple: Cellar - Going left takes you to the final boss fight of this chapter. Going right, however, leads to this Meditation Spot, as well as another meeting with the hermit.

He’s right in front of several Buddha statues. Kingdom of Sahali: Sandgate Bound - On a ridge overlooking the desert in the Kingdom of Sahali secret area . Snowhill Path: Mirrormere - Next to the large tree just before the frozen lake.

Bitter Lake: Precept Corridor - At Bitter Lake, follow the middle path that leads to a large tunnel system. This Meditation Spot is near the Precept Corridor waypoint. The Enhanced Tiger Subduing Pellets formula is also nearby.

Valley of Ecstasy: Mindfulness Cliff - Complete the second boss encounter against Non-White, which also unlocks a new spirit skill , so you can interact with this Meditation Spot. New Thunderclap Temple: Mahavira Hall - Guarded by the Non-Pure spirit boss, who can be found in a small building at the right-hand side of the Mahavira Hall grounds in New Thunderclap Temple. Webbed Hollow: Pool of Shattered Jade - It's going to be a doozy to find this Black Myth: Wukong Meditation Spot.

Basically, from the Upper Hollow Shrine, you need to go to the section with several insect sacs. Then, look for a ledge that allows you to drop down. This takes you to a tunnel system with spider sacs that will attack as you get close enough.

At the very end of this tunnel, there’s a sloping path that leads to the Pool of Shattered Jade waypoint. This Meditation Spot is in the middle of the pond. Note: The boss fight here pits you against the Venom Daoist, which is actually part of this chapter’s secret side quest.

We discuss this further in our Chapter 4 secret area guide . Webbed Hollow: Middle Hollow - Continue past the Verdure Bridge village and you’ll stumble upon the Middle Hollow shrine. The Meditation Spot is nearby.

Webbed Hollow: Lower Hollow - Just before the Lower Hollow shrine, you’ll notice a narrow opening in the tunnel. Go through it to tag this Meditation Spot. Temple of Yellow Flowers: Forest of Ferocity - Once you’ve tagged the Forest of Ferocity waypoint, go to the left-hand side.

You’ll see this Meditation Spot at the edge of a cliff. Temple of Yellow Flowers: Temple Entrance - Upon entering the temple grounds, check the right-hand side for a yard with numerous snake monks. Note that the Snake Sheriff spirit elite , the hermit NPC, and an Awaken Wine Worm are also in this area.

Woods of Ember: Camp of Seasons - On a scaffolding right after you defeat the Brown-Iron Cart, the first Five Element Cart you’ll encounter in the level. Furnace Valley: The Emerald Hall - If you’re facing the throne in the Emerald Hall, make your way to the far-left section of this area that’s overlooking the lava flows. You’ll see this Meditation Spot in front of a Buddha statue.

Field of Fire: Ashen Pass III - At the Ashen Pass III shrine, there’s a metal ball that will roll around and squish your character dead. It will also roll and destroy the wall at the back of the shrine. This opens up a small clearing with this Black Myth: Wukong Meditation Spot.

Bishui Cave: Purge Pit - You need to gain access to the Chapter 5 secret area . After eliminating the initial set of bull mobs, check the next chamber and look to your right. The Purge Pit shrine is also nearby.
